RED LION (circa 1700)

RED LION (circa 1700) A lovely early 18th century English provincial tent stitch picture. The large flowers on the right and the chunky block shading is reminiscent of the treatment done on other pastoral pieces of this period. The oak tree, spotted dog, red lion, and feline form on right (possibly a panther) are
all stitched in tent stitch, as is most of the background although one area is worked in queen stitch and another uses silk chenille which is couched down. Formerly in the collection of The Essamplaire.
